Grace Stebbing’s ‘Gold and Glory; or, Wild Ways of Other Days, a Tale of Early American Discovery’ is a gripping historical fiction novel that delves into the era of early American exploration. Through vivid storytelling and richly detailed descriptions, Stebbing immerses the reader in the adventurous spirit of early settlers and the quest for riches and glory. The book combines elements of romance, danger, and intrigue, making it a compelling read for those interested in American history and exploration literature. Stebbing’s prose is both evocative and engaging, transporting the reader back to a time of discovery and wonder. Grace Stebbing, known for her meticulous research and dedication to historical accuracy, drew inspiration from tales of early American expeditions and the brave men and women who ventured into unknown territories in search of treasure. Her passion for history and storytelling shines through in ‘Gold and Glory’, as she weaves a captivating narrative that captures the challenges and triumphs of America’s early explorers. Stebbing’s expertise in early American history is evident in her detailed descriptions and authentic portrayal of the time period.
